Possible cyberattack disrupts patient access at Kansas hospital

Patients have reported being unable to reach El Dorado, Kan.-based Susan B. Allen Memorial Hospital to schedule critical appointments, KWCH reported July 17.

The hospital is investigating a potential cyberattack.

In a statement to the news outlet, Susan B. Allen Memorial Hospital said it had “detected anomalous activity” in its network, which led to a system outage. It has engaged a third-party cybersecurity team to investigate and support recovery efforts.

The hospital said it will notify patients if their personal information was compromised.

The investigation is ongoing, according to KWCH.
